Transaction 66dd2e01ee7a168b12fd8ae431f8a246f1c20c368f92b97eda4c433d4c9eae10
1 Input
2 Outputs
- 66dd2e01ee7a168b12fd8ae431f8a246f1c20c368f92b97eda4c433d4c9eae10:0
- 66dd2e01ee7a168b12fd8ae431f8a246f1c20c368f92b97eda4c433d4c9eae10:1
value 147944
address 1EKPdUMWXzAEVwMpb6PyPD5Diiq3ge226V
value 10397288
address 12HzcKVgtT9AfYeccmnX9dsuoTKwThDHjC